Confirmed cases of West Nile virus in birds for a sample of six counties in the state of Georgia are shown below. County Cases Catoosa 6 Chattooga 3 Dade 3 Gordon 5 Murray 3 Walker 4 We are interested in testing the following hypotheses regarding these data: H0:   3 Ha:  > 3
 a. Compute the mean and the standard deviation of the sample.
  b. Compute the standard error of the mean.
  c. Determine the test statistic.
  d. Determine the p-value and at 95 confidence, test the hypotheses.

Question 2

You are given the following information obtained from a random sample of 4 observations. 25 47 32 56 You want to determine whether or not the mean of the population from which this sample was taken is significantly different from 48 . (Assume the population is normally distributed.)
 a. State the null and the alternative hypotheses.
  b. Determine the test statistic.
  c. Determine the p-value; and at 95 confidence test to determine whether or not the mean of the population is significantly different from 48.

Answer to Question 1

a. 4 and 1.265 (rounded)
b. 0.5164
c. t = 1.94 (rounded)
d. p-value is between 0.05 and 0.1; reject H0 and conclude that the mean of the population is significantly more than 3.

Answer to Question 2

a. H0:  = 48
Ha:   48
b. t = -1.137
c. p-value is between 0.2 and 0.4 (two tailed); do not reject H0.

Chronic necrotizing aspergillosis has a slowly progressive process that, unlike invasive aspergillosis, does not spread to other organ systems or the blood vessels. It most often affects middle-aged and elderly individuals, spreading to surrounding tissue in the lungs. The disease often does not respond to conventionally successful treatments, and requires individualized therapies in order to keep it from becoming life-threatening.
